✨ About The Role
- The Software Engineer will collaborate with cross-functional teams to design, develop, and deploy software solutions for Fleet Management of humanoid robots.
- Responsibilities include implementing features for real-time monitoring, tracking, and management of robot fleets.
- The role involves integrating sensor data and telemetry information to enhance fleet performance and operational efficiency.
- Developing APIs and interfaces for communication between Fleet Management software and robotic systems is a key task.
- The engineer will participate in code reviews, testing, and debugging to maintain software reliability and quality.
âš¡ Requirements
- A bachelor's degree in Computer Science, Engineering, or a related field is required, with a master's degree preferred.
- The ideal candidate will have over 5 years of experience in software engineering, particularly in developing scalable applications.
- Proficiency in programming languages such as Python, Java, or C++ is essential for success in this role.
- Experience with cloud platforms and microservices architecture will be beneficial for optimizing fleet management solutions.
- Strong problem-solving skills and attention to detail are crucial for ensuring high-quality software releases.